Ingredients List
Crafting these delightful Cheesy Garlic Chicken Wraps starts with a selection of fresh, vibrant, and incredibly flavorful ingredients. Each component plays a crucial role in building the irresistible taste profile that makes this one of our go-to easy weeknight dinners.
- For the Cheesy Garlic Chicken:
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: A good quality extra virgin olive oil enhances the flavor and helps achieve that perfect golden-brown on your chicken.
- 1.5 p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s: Cut into 1-inch pieces. Chicken breasts offer a leaner option, while thighs provide a juicier, richer flavor. Feel free to use what you prefer or have on hand!
- 4 cloves garlic, minced: The heart of our garlic flavor! Freshly minced garlic is always best for maximum aromatic impact.
- 1 teaspoon dried Italian seasoning: A versatile blend that adds a wonderful herbaceous depth.
- ½ teaspoon salt: Adjust to your taste preferences.
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per: Freshly ground makes a difference.
- ½ cup chicken broth: Adds moisture and helps form a light sauce. Low-sodium is a great alternative for better control over salt content.
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ese: The star of the “cheesy” part! Feel free to use a blend like Italian cheese mix for added complexity.
- 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ese: Adds a salty, umami kick.
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ped: For a pop of freshness and color.
- For the Wraps:
- 6-8 large flour tortillas (burrito size): Choose your favorite brand. Whole wheat tortillas are an excellent healthy alternative.
- Optional fresh toppings: Sh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, thinly sliced red onion, or a dollop of sour cream/Greek yogurt for a cool contrast.

Step 1: Prep the Chicken
Start by patting your chicken pieces dry with paper towels. This crucial step ensures a better sear and keeps the chicken from steaming. Toss the chicken with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ning directly in a bowl. For an extra boost of flavor penetration, you can let the seasoned chicken sit for 5-10 minutes while you gather your other ingredients.
Step 2: Sear the Chicken to Golden Perfection
Heat the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et or non-stick pan over medium-high heat. Once the oil shimmers, add the seasoned chicken in a single layer,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. Cook for 3-4 minutes per side until beautifully golden brown and cooked through. Overcrowding can lower the pan’s temperature and prevent that desirable crust, so cook in batches if necessary.
Step 3: Infuse with Garlic and Broth
Reduce the heat to medium. Add the minced garlic to the pan and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it can turn bitter quickly. Pour in the chicken broth,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pan – this is where much of the flavor lies! Let it simmer for 2-3 minutes, allowing the liquid to slightly reduce and the flavors to meld.
Step 4: Add the Cheese
Remove the skillet from the heat. Stir in the sh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heese until melted and gooey, coating the chicken uniformly. The residual heat from the chicken and the pan will be enough to melt the cheese beautifully, creating a rich, luscious sauce. If needed, you can return it to very low heat for a few seconds to fully melt the cheese, but be careful not to overheat it, which can make the cheese stringy.
Step 5: Warm the Tortillas
While the cheese melts, warm your tortillas. You can do this in a dry skillet over medium heat for 15-20 seconds per side until pliable, microwave them in a stack wrapped in a damp paper towel for 30 seconds, or even briefly char them over an open gas flame for a subtle smoky flavor. Warm tortillas are far less likely to tear when rolled.
Step 6: Assemble and Garnish
Divide the cheesy garlic chicken mixture evenly among the warmed tortillas. If desired, add your favorite fresh toppings like sh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, or a dollop of Greek yogurt for a refreshing contrast. Roll them up tightly, tucking in the sides to create a neat wrap. Garnish with fresh chopped parsley if you like, for an extra touch of color and aroma.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Even the simplest of easy weeknight dinners can be undermined by common culinary pitfalls. Based on my years of experience, here are the top mistakes often made with recipes like these Cheesy Garlic Chicken Wraps, and how to expertly avoid them:
- Overcrowding the Pan: This is perhaps the most frequent error when searing chicken. When you add too much chicken to a hot pan, the temperature drops dramatically. Instead of searing, the chicken will steam, resulting in a pale, rubbery texture rather than a golden, flavorful crust.
- Solution: Cook the chicken in batches. This might take an extra few minutes, but the superior texture and flavor are well worth it. Evidence suggests that proper searing can lock in up to 15% more moisture than steaming, creating juicier chicken.
- Burning the Garlic: Minced garlic cooks very quickly. If you add it too early or cook it on too high a heat, it can burn, creating a bitter, acrid taste that will permeate your entire dish.
- Solution: Add the garlic after the chicken is mostly cooked, and only sauté for 30-60 seconds until fragrant. Keep a close eye on it!
- Overcooking the Chicken: Dry, tough chicken is a sure way to ruin a wrap. Chicken breasts, especially, can go from perfectly juicy to overdone in a matter of moments.
- Solution: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). Remove it from the heat as soon as it hits this mark. A recent survey showed that 45% of home cooks admit to overcooking chicken, indicating a widespread problem that’s easily fixed with a thermometer.
- Not Warming the Tortillas: Cold, stiff tortillas are prone to cracking and breaking when you try to roll them, leading to messy wraps and frustration.
- Solution: Always warm your tortillas until they are pliable. This takes mere seconds and significantly improves the wrapping experience.
- Adding Cheese to Boiling Liquid: If you dump your cheese into a pan of simmering or boiling broth, the fats and proteins in the cheese can separate, leading to a grainy, oily texture instead of a smooth, creamy sauce.
- Solution: Remove the pan from the heat before stirring in the cheese. The residual heat will be sufficient to melt it into a luscious, cohesive sauce.

Storage Tips
Having delicious leftovers or components prepped for future meals is a game-changer for maintaining those easy weeknight dinners. Here’s how to best store your Cheesy Garlic Chicken Wraps or their components to maximize freshness and flavor:
- Cooked Chicken Mixture:
- Refrigeration: The cheesy garlic chicken mixture can be stored separately from the tortillas. Place it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. This is fantastic for meal prepping – you can cook a larger batch of the chicken and assemble fresh wraps throughout the week!
- Freezing: While you can freeze the cooked chicken, the cheesy sauce might change texture slightly upon thawing (it can become a bit grainy). If freezing, ensure it’s in a freezer-safe, airtight container for up to 2-3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ator and gently reheat on the stovetop over low heat, adding a splash of broth if it seems too thick.
- Assembled Wraps:
- Refrigeration: If you’ve already assembled the wraps with fresh toppings like lettuce and tomato, they are best eaten immediately. The moisture from the fillings can make the tortillas soggy if stored for too long. If you must store an assembled wrap,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and consume within 1 day.
- Meal Prep without Assembly: For the best results for meal prep, store the chicken mixture and fresh toppings separately. Assemble the wraps just before eating to maintain optimal texture and prevent sogginess.
- Tortillas:
- Store unused tortillas in their original packaging, tightly sealed, at room temperature or in the refrigerator according to package directions. They typically last a week or more this way.
Best Practices for Preserving Freshness and Flavor: Always ensure containers are airtight to prevent odors from other foods from affecting your wraps and to keep moisture locked in (or out, in the case of tortillas). When reheating the chicken mixture, do so gently over medium-low heat on the stovetop or in the microwave, stirring occasionally, to prevent drying out and to ensure the cheese melts smoothly again.

FAQ
Q1: Can I use pre-cooked chicken for this recipe?
A1: Absolutely! Using pre-cooked rotisserie chicken or leftover grilled chicken can shave even more time off your prep, potentially reducing the total time to under 15 minutes. Simply shred or dice the pre-cooked chicken and add it to the pan with the garlic and broth, then proceed with adding the cheese. This is a brilliant hack for truly easy weeknight dinners!
Q2: What if I don’t have Italian seasoning?
A2: No problem! You can create your own blend using a mix of dried oregano, thyme, basil, and a pinch of rosemary. A dash of onion powder can also complement the garlic beautifully. Start with ½ teaspoon oregano and ¼ teaspoon basil/thyme, adjusting to your preference.
Q3: Can I make these ahead of time for lunch meal prep?
A3: Yes, but with a small caveat. The best approach for meal prep is to cook the cheesy garlic chicken mixture and store it separately in an airtight container for up to 3-4 days in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to eat, simply reheat the chicken, warm a fresh tortilla, and assemble your wrap. This prevents the tortillas from becoming soggy and keeps your fresh toppings crisp.
Q4: How can I make these wraps spicier?
A4: To add a kick, you have a few options! You can add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the chicken along with the Italian seasoning, or a tiny dash of cayenne pepper. For an even more prominent heat, consider adding a finely diced jalapeño or serrano pepper with the garlic. A drizzle of your favorite hot sauce before serving is also a quick and easy way to adjust the spice level.
Q5: What other cheeses pair well with this recipe?
A5: While mozzarella and Parmesan are classic, feel free to experiment! Provolone, Monterey Jack, or even a sharp white cheddar could be delicious alternatives or additions. A blend of cheeses can offer a more complex flavor profile. Just ensure they melt smoothly. For a smoky flavor, a small amount of smoked gouda could be interesting!
